Ruth Marie Erickson
April 13th, 1920 to October 22nd, 2011
Ruth Marie Erickson, 91, of Marysville, died Saturday, October 22, 2011.
She was born April 13, 1920 in Tabor, Iowa to the late Frank and Ruby Leonard. She married Wayne E.A. Erickson on May 8, 1943 in Omaha, Nebraska.
Ruth was a member of First Baptist Church in Port Huron and a former member of Cherry Hill Baptist Church in Dearborn Heights. While at Cherry Hill, Ruth enjoyed her task of making sure that the church newsletter was always mailed on time. She was also an avid bowler and a sports fan, especially of the Detroit Tigers and college football.
She is survived by her husband of 68 years, Wayne; a daughter, Mary (Noel) Bedy of St. Clair; granddaughter, Nicole Bedy of St. Clair; grandson, Michael (Michelle) Bedy of New Hampshire; great grandchildren, Isabelle Ruth and Owen James Bedy; and several nieces and nephews.
She was preceded in death by her siblings, Walter Leonard, Helen McClure, and Betty June Wilson.
Visitation will be 2-4 & 6-8 p.m. Tuesday in Marysville Funeral Home.
Funeral services will be held at 11:00 a.m. on Wednesday, October 26, 2011 in Marysville Funeral Home. The Reverend Daniel S. Bakay of First Baptist Church will officiate.
Memorials may be made to First Baptist Church.
